Your article should address a specific search query and align with E-E-A-T (Expertise, Experience, Authoritativeness, Trustworthiness) guidelines.
We only accept original, unpublished content.
The content must be highly relevant to the EzyCourse audience and align with our core focus on online learning and education.
Provide actionable insights, practical tips, or thought-provoking ideas that will benefit our readers.
Aim for a minimum of 1500 words to ensure sufficient depth and details. Longer articles (2500+) words are generally preferred.
Incorporate relevant keywords naturally throughout the article.
Write in clear, concise, and grammatically correct American English. Use simple, easy-to-understand language.
Maintain an informative and authoritative tone while engaging readers with a conversational style.
Link to relevant pages within the EzyCourse website when approp
Try to include a limited number of high-quality, relevant external links (DR 50+). Also, try to provide sources for any facts or statistics to maximize authoritativeness.
